Can A Retail Salesperson Afford Rent in Lago Vista, TX?

Rent-burdened — rent takes 67.6% of gross income.

Lago Vista rent: June 2026. Salary: BLS OEWS May 2024 (Texas state estimate).

Lago Vista median rent
$2,066/mo
Retail Salesperson salary (Texas)
$36,699/yr
Rent as % of income
67.6%
Gross monthly income works out to about $3,058, and the 30% rule supports up to $917/mo in rent. Lago Vista's median rent of $2,066 exceeds that threshold by $1,149/mo, putting a retail salesperson salary into the rent-burdened range here. A retail salesperson works roughly 117.1 hours a month to cover that rent.

Methodology: Salary uses the BLS-derived Texas state estimate from OEWS May 2024. Rent is the most recent ZORI monthly value for Lago Vista, TX. Affordability applies the 30% rule (rent ≤ 30% of gross income). Real take-home varies with taxes, household composition, overtime, tips, and benefits.
